Agriculture — Yaroslavl Oblast

Gross harvest of vegetables in Yaroslavl Oblast in 2002: 153.139 thousand tonnes.
Change versus 2001: −33.327 thousand tonnes (indicator fell by 17.9%).
In 2002, Yaroslavl Oblast holds position 26 in the list by magnitude out of 80 (full regional ranking).
The Russian average in 2002 was 10,664.71 thousand tonnes. The region's value is below the national average.
